Kerosene Prices Increase by 25% In a Single Year

—

In the past year, there has been a 25.18 percent increase in the price of kerosene and a 1.7% increase in the price of cooking gas.

In its October 2023 report on household kerosene and cooking gas, the National Bureau of Statistics (NBS) reports that the average retail price per liter of household kerosene (HHK) paid by consumers in October 2023 increased from N1,041.05 in October 2022 to N1,303.16, indicating a year-over-year increase of 25.18 percent.

On a month-over-month basis, nevertheless, the gain from N1,299.03 in September increased by 0.32 percent.
The average retail price of refueling a 5 kg cylinder with liquefied petroleum gas (LPG), commonly referred to as cooking gas, climbed from N4,483.75 in October 2022 to N4,562.51 in October 2023, suggesting a 1.7% annual increase.

However, the price grew month over month, from N4,189.96 in September to N4,562.51 in October—an increase of 8.89%.

According to state profile research, Adamawa had the highest average price per liter of household kerosene in October 2023 at N1,676.19. Abia came in second with N1,555.21 and Abuja third with N1,541.67.
Kwara had the lowest price, N1,034.29, followed by Kebbi (N1,133.33) and Enugu (N1,134.52).

Refilling a 5-kg LPG cylinder cost N5,181.43, the most in Kano, followed by N5,142.86 in Adamawa and N5,093.75 in Ogun. Ebonyi had the lowest average cost, N3,971.43, followed by N4,000 in Osun and N4,025 in Edo.
